It’s day one of the first Test between Australia and New Zealand in Perth.
The hosts won the toss and chose to bat first in the day-night encounter.
Australia have fielded an unchanged side for the third match in a row, while the Black Caps have replaced the injured Trent Boult with Lockie Ferguson.
The Aussies have not lost a series at home to New Zealand since 1985.
